Foil films are versatile materials used across various industries. They are essential for packaging, insulation, and printing. Understanding the different types can help buyers make informed choices that align with their specific needs.
Aluminum foil film is a popular choice. It offers excellent barrier properties against light, moisture, and oxygen. This makes it ideal for food packaging. However, it can be prone to punctures if not handled with care. Another option is polyester foil film, known for its durability and strength. It is often used in labeling and graphics. The glossy finish provides an attractive appearance, but it may scratch easily.
Reflective foil films also deserve attention. They are used in insulation and energy-saving applications. These films reflect heat effectively, contributing to energy efficiency. Yet, they may not be suitable for all climates. Buyers should assess their local environments and specific requirements. Foil films have gained prominence across various industries due to their unique properties. In the food packaging sector, they provide an effective barrier against moisture and light. This helps to preserve freshness and extend shelf life. Using foil films ensures that products remain uncontaminated and have a longer market viability.
In the pharmaceutical industry, foil films play a critical role in protecting sensitive medications. These films shield pills from environmental factors that can diminish their effectiveness. Many manufacturers rely on foil films for their strength and protective qualities. However, not all foil films meet strict pharmaceutical standards, leading to potential challenges.
In the electronics field, foil films are used to create flexible printed circuits. They offer excellent conductivity while remaining lightweight. However, manufacturers often face issues with the durability of these films. Balancing performance and cost can be tricky. The comparative analysis of foil film materials reveals critical insights for global buyers in 2026. Different types of foil films offer varying properties that suit specific applications. For instance, aluminum foil is renowned for its excellent barrier properties against moisture, gases, and light. A recent industry report indicated that over 45% of packaging applications in food industries prefer aluminum types for their high durability and insulation features.
However, alternatives such as PET (polyethylene terephthalate) foil films are gaining traction. They are lighter and often deemed more environmentally friendly than traditional aluminum. Data from market research shows that the demand for PET films has surged by 30% in the last three years. This shift highlights a possible change in consumer preferences toward sustainable materials. Yet, while performance is critical, issues like recyclability and production costs remain points for reflection.
Another emerging type is BOPP (biaxially oriented polypropylene) films, often used in non-food applications. These films are lightweight and provide clarity but may lack some barrier properties of aluminum films. A recent comparative study pointed out that about 20% of users reported challenges with moisture retention. It’s essential for companies to weigh these factors carefully.
